1

当我使用 SpreadsheetApp.openById("abc12s4562") 打开共享的谷歌文档电子表格时,我想知道是否有人正在阅读电子表格,如果是真的,我想显示一个弹出窗口来通知读者。你认为有可能做到这一点吗?如何 ?

4

1 回答 1

0

当有人打开电子表格时可以“检测”到,但事实并非如此。您所拥有的是可以挂钩以触发脚本的事件onOpenonEdit事件,然后您可以向用户弹出一些内容。

弹出窗口不能被这样的脚本任意触发。而且没有办法知道是否有人正在查看电子表格,您只有onEdit.

如果您想警告用户脚本正在处理电子表格,他们应该稍等片刻。您可以更改电子表格本身的一些视觉设置。可能会更改部分或所有单元格的背景颜色。甚至以编程方式保护工作表以真正避免并发问题。

于 2012-11-13T11:05:39.233 回答